Artist:
Lockhart, Paul, sculptor.
Title:
Flying Geese, (
sculpture
).
Digital Reference:
Medium:
Sculpture
: bronze; Base: concrete, painted.
Dimensions:
Sculpture
: approx. H. 18 ft.; Base: approx. 16 x 5 x 5 ft.
Inscription:
unsigned
Description:
Sixteen larger-than-life geese are spiraling around a tall, white-painted, pyramidal-shaped base in various stages of landing. The
sculpture
and base are enclosed within a low border.

Owner:
Sailwinds Park, West of Route 50, beside Choptank River,
Cambridge
,
Maryland
Remarks:
The
sculpture
was built on a landfill made from sand pumped from the channel of the Choptank River.
